Seraph Group

Seraph Group is a venture capital firm based in Milton, Georgia, focusing on early-stage investments in technology startups. It operates a structured angel fund model, targeting high-growth companies across various sectors.

Seraph Group as a funder

Investment thesis

Pioneered the 'Structured Angel Fund' model — a hybrid between traditional angel investing and VC. Each fund takes positions in 20+ early-stage tech companies under direct partner management, giving LPs diversified seed exposure with deal-by-deal co-invest rights.

Focus narrative

Seraph Group invests in early-stage, high-growth companies across diverse industries. The firm offers structured angel funds that provide exposure to a portfolio of 20-30 companies, as well as growth equity funds for follow-on investments in top-performing portfolio companies. It targets venture-scalable companies at the seed and early stages, and its investment strategy is industry and geography-agnostic.

Value beyond capital

Seraph Group provides structured angel funds that allow investors to gain diversified exposure to early-stage companies. The firm also offers growth equity funds for follow-on investments in top-performing portfolio companies, enhancing the potential for returns.

Portfolio context

Notable portfolio companies include: Aerospace Boom: Developing a prototype for a passenger plane that will be 2.6 times faster than current aircraft. 4AG Robotics: Builds robots to automate mushroom farming operations. Aarki: A mobile ad platform that enhances user interaction with mobile advertisements. ACTNano: Develops protective coatings for PCB chips in automotive and consumer electronics. AI Optics: Creates handheld imaging technology and AI-based disease screening software. AirDog: A foldable drone designed for autonomous video shooting in action sports. Aluna: Developed the first FDA-approved portable spirometer for monitoring lung health. AreaMetrics: Provides customer analytics and engagement solutions for offline merchants. Asankya: Offers solutions for cloud-based applications and streaming services. Authoritive: A platform for content creators to enhance reach and engagement. Ava: Automated transcription services for the deaf and hard-of-hearing. Block Party: Filters spam and unwanted trolls on social media networks.

Community overview

Seraph Group is an investment organization founded in 2004 and based in Milton, Georgia. The firm focuses on early-stage investments, having deployed over $195 million across more than 150 startups in various sectors and geographies. It operates with a network of over 400 investors and has a track record of managing 13 funds.
